TestDisk PhotoRec:免费开源数据恢复工具终极指南,拯救你的宝贵数据
TestDisk PhotoRec免费开源数据恢复工具终极指南拯救你的宝贵数据【免费下载链接】testdiskTestDisk PhotoRec项目地址: https://gitcode.com/gh_mirrors/te/testdisk你是否曾经因为误删重要文件而心急如焚或者遇到过硬盘分区突然消失重要资料无法访问的困境别担心今天我要为你介绍两款功能强大的开源数据恢复神器——TestDisk和PhotoRec。这两款完全免费的工具组合能够帮你解决绝大多数数据丢失问题无论是误删除、格式化还是分区损坏都能给你带来一线希望。 数据丢失的噩梦为什么你需要这些工具想象一下这些场景不小心清空了回收站里面有你几个月的工作文档硬盘突然无法识别里面有珍贵的家庭照片和视频系统重装时选错了磁盘把数据盘给格式化了SD卡损坏旅行的美好回忆眼看就要消失这些情况每天都在发生而TestDisk和PhotoRec就是你的数据救援队。它们不是普通的文件恢复软件而是专业的开源数据恢复工具由全球开发者共同维护功能强大且完全免费。PhotoRec数据恢复工具图标 - 开源数据恢复的强大工具️ 工具介绍TestDisk和PhotoRec分别能做什么TestDisk分区修复专家TestDisk专门处理磁盘分区问题。当你的硬盘分区表损坏、分区丢失或者引导扇区出问题时TestDisk就能大显身手。它支持几乎所有主流文件系统包括Windows的NTFS、FATLinux的Ext2/3/4macOS的HFS等等。主要功能修复损坏的分区表恢复误删除的分区重建引导扇区修复FAT、NTFS引导扇区从丢失的分区中恢复文件PhotoRec文件恢复大师PhotoRec专注于从存储介质中恢复丢失的文件。它不依赖于文件系统而是通过扫描磁盘的原始数据识别480多种文件格式的签名来恢复文件。这意味着即使文件系统完全损坏PhotoRec也能帮你找回文件。强大之处支持480种文件格式不依赖文件系统直接从原始数据恢复支持图片、文档、视频、音频等各种文件类型跨平台运行支持Windows、Linux、macOS 为什么选择开源数据恢复工具在众多数据恢复软件中TestDisk和PhotoRec凭借其独特的优势脱颖而出对比维度TestDisk PhotoRec商业恢复软件价格完全免费昂贵通常数百到数千元隐私安全本地运行数据不离开你的电脑可能上传数据到云端功能完整性分区修复文件恢复一站式解决通常只能做文件恢复技术支持开源社区支持问题反馈快客服响应但可能收费可定制性开源代码可自行修改定制闭源无法修改核心优势总结完全免费不用担心试用版限制或高昂的授权费用隐私安全所有操作都在本地完成敏感数据不会外泄功能全面从底层分区修复到上层文件恢复一站式解决持续更新开源社区活跃不断添加对新文件格式的支持 快速开始5分钟上手数据恢复安装方法超简单方法一直接下载推荐新手对于Windows用户可以直接从官网下载预编译版本解压即可使用无需安装。方法二包管理器安装Linux/macOS# Ubuntu/Debian sudo apt install testdisk # CentOS/RHEL sudo yum install testdisk # macOS brew install testdisk方法三源码编译适合开发者如果你想体验最新功能或自定义编译git clone https://gitcode.com/gh_mirrors/te/testdisk cd testdisk ./autogen.sh ./configure make sudo make install你的第一次数据恢复实战场景误删了U盘里的重要照片解决步骤立即停止使用U盘- 这是最重要的原则避免新数据覆盖旧数据启动PhotoRec- 打开终端输入photorec启动程序选择存储设备- 找到你的U盘对应的设备如/dev/sdb1选择文件系统类型- 根据U盘格式选择FAT32或exFAT指定保存位置- 选择另一个硬盘或分区来保存恢复的文件开始扫描恢复- 耐心等待PhotoRec会自动识别并恢复文件小贴士恢复的文件会按类型分类保存方便你后续整理。 支持的文件格式超乎想象的全面PhotoRec支持的文件格式之多令人惊叹几乎涵盖了所有常见文件类型图片文件恢复成功率极高常见格式JPG、PNG、GIF、BMP、TIFFRAW格式佳能CR2、尼康NEF、索尼ARW、富士RAF等专业格式PSD、AI、CDR等设计文件文档与办公文件Office文档DOC、DOCX、XLS、XLSX、PPT、PPTXPDF文档各种版本的PDF文件文本文件TXT、RTF、HTML、XML等代码文件C、Java、Python、JavaScript等源代码多媒体文件视频文件MP4、AVI、MKV、MOV、WMV、FLV音频文件MP3、WAV、FLAC、AAC、OGG压缩文件ZIP、RAR、7Z、TAR等系统与特殊文件数据库文件SQLite、MySQL、Access等虚拟机磁盘VMDK、VDI、VHD等磁盘镜像ISO、IMG、BIN等这些文件格式的支持都在项目的src/file_*.c文件中实现每个文件对应一种格式的识别算法。 实用技巧提高数据恢复成功率黄金法则立即停止尽快行动数据恢复最重要的原则就是时间就是成功率。一旦发现数据丢失立即停止使用该存储设备不要写入任何新数据尽快开始恢复操作选择合适的恢复模式快速扫描模式适合最近删除的文件扫描速度快几分钟内完成恢复最近删除的文件效果最好深度扫描模式适合格式化或严重损坏的情况扫描整个磁盘的每个扇区耗时较长但恢复更全面保存位置的选择技巧绝对不要将恢复的文件保存到原磁盘选择另一个物理硬盘或分区确保目标位置有足够的空间最好使用外部硬盘或网络存储文件过滤功能PhotoRec支持按文件类型过滤这能大大提升恢复效率只恢复特定类型的文件如只恢复图片排除不需要的文件类型按文件大小过滤避免恢复大量小文件⚠️ 常见误区与避坑指南误区一格式化后数据就彻底消失了真相格式化只是删除了文件系统的索引实际数据还在磁盘上。只要没有新数据写入用PhotoRec深度扫描有很大概率能恢复。误区二SSD和HDD恢复方法一样区别HDD硬盘数据删除后还在原位置直到被覆盖SSD固态硬盘TRIM功能会立即擦除已删除数据恢复窗口更短建议SSD数据丢失要立即断电避免TRIM执行误区三恢复的文件都能正常打开实际情况完整恢复的文件可以正常打开部分覆盖的文件可能损坏严重碎片化的文件可能不完整建议恢复后立即验证重要文件误区四商业软件一定比开源工具好对比分析商业软件界面友好操作简单但价格昂贵TestDisk/PhotoRec功能强大完全免费但需要一些技术知识选择建议先尝试开源工具复杂情况再考虑商业软件️ 高级应用TestDisk分区修复实战分区表损坏的修复步骤当你的硬盘突然无法识别或者系统无法启动时可能是分区表出了问题启动TestDisksudo testdisk /dev/sda选择磁盘分析选择Analyse进入分析模式使用Quick Search快速搜索丢失的分区识别和选择分区TestDisk会列出找到的分区检查分区信息是否正确写入修复确认无误后选择Write写入修复重启系统检查修复效果误删除分区的恢复如果你不小心删除了整个分区使用Deep Search深度搜索功能TestDisk会扫描整个磁盘寻找分区痕迹找到后重建分区表重要恢复前先备份当前分区表状态不同文件系统的恢复技巧文件系统恢复特点注意事项NTFS恢复成功率最高注意日志文件的影响FAT32结构简单容易恢复文件大小限制4GBExt4Linux常用恢复效果好注意inode分配情况HFSmacOS系统恢复较复杂注意日志记录exFAT大容量存储设备常用相对容易恢复 性能优化与进阶技巧命令行参数详解想要更高效地使用这些工具试试这些参数TestDisk实用参数# 记录详细日志方便排查问题 testdisk /log recovery.log # 列出所有可用磁盘 testdisk /list # 指定磁盘进行操作 testdisk /dev/sdbPhotoRec性能优化# 指定恢复目录 photorec /d /recovery_folder # 使用多线程加速4线程 photorec /threads 4 # 低内存模式适合大容量磁盘 photorec /lowmem # 只恢复特定文件类型 photorec /ext jpg,png,doc自动化脚本示例创建定期磁盘健康检查脚本#!/bin/bash # 磁盘健康监控脚本 echo 磁盘健康检查报告 date for disk in /dev/sd[a-z]; do if [ -b $disk ]; then echo 检查磁盘: $disk # 检查SMART状态 smartctl -H $disk | grep -q PASSED echo ✓ SMART状态正常 || echo ✗ SMART状态异常 # 检查坏道 badblocks -sv $disk 21 | grep -q 0 bad blocks echo ✓ 无坏道 || echo ✗ 发现坏道 fi done 不同场景的最佳恢复策略场景一误删除单个文件最佳做法立即停止使用该磁盘使用PhotoRec快速扫描模式按文件类型过滤提高效率恢复后验证文件完整性场景二格式化整个分区操作流程不要向该分区写入任何数据使用PhotoRec深度扫描按文件类型分类恢复使用TestDisk尝试恢复分区结构场景三硬盘无法识别解决步骤检查硬件连接是否正常使用TestDisk分析分区表如果分区表损坏尝试修复修复成功后用PhotoRec恢复文件场景四手机/SD卡数据丢失特别注意将存储卡设为只读模式使用读卡器连接到电脑PhotoRec选择Whole Disk模式只恢复需要的文件类型如照片、视频 未来发展与学习路径项目源码结构如果你对技术实现感兴趣可以深入研究项目源码核心模块目录src/file_*.c- 480多种文件格式的识别模块src/part*.c- 各种分区表的处理逻辑src/diskacc.c- 磁盘访问层处理底层IO操作src/fat.c,src/ntfs.c- 具体文件系统的实现配置文件目录config/- 包含各种配置文件示例doc/- 详细的技术文档进阶学习建议基础掌握熟练使用命令行参数和基本操作场景实践在不同数据丢失场景下练习使用源码研究了解文件签名识别和分区表解析原理社区贡献参与问题讨论或提交代码改进数据安全的最佳实践记住最好的数据恢复是预防数据丢失定期备份遵循3-2-1备份原则3份备份2种介质1份异地监控磁盘健康定期检查SMART状态使用RAID重要数据使用RAID保护云存储备份关键数据同步到云端 总结你的数据安全卫士TestDisk和PhotoRec作为开源数据恢复的标杆工具不仅功能强大、完全免费更重要的是它们代表了开源社区对数据安全的重视和技术积累。无论你是普通用户还是技术专家掌握这些工具都能在关键时刻拯救宝贵的数据资产。关键要点回顾TestDisk修复分区PhotoRec恢复文件两者互补支持480文件格式覆盖绝大多数常见文件完全免费开源无任何使用限制跨平台支持Windows/Linux/macOS都能用隐私安全所有操作都在本地完成最后建议 现在就下载TestDisk和PhotoRec把它们放在你的工具箱里。你永远不知道什么时候会需要它们但当数据丢失的危机来临时你会庆幸自己早有准备。记住冷静操作、及时行动、善用工具你就能最大限度地保护你的数据安全 ️【免费下载链接】testdiskTestDisk PhotoRec项目地址: https://gitcode.com/gh_mirrors/te/testdisk创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考